Make Travis use Liberica JDK.

This commit is contained in:
esaunders 2020-08-29 16:22:24 -04:00
parent fe7b3c4f94
commit b4ba94969c

View File

@ -25,10 +25,7 @@ addons:
- ant-optional - ant-optional
- libcppunit-dev - libcppunit-dev
- wget - wget
- openjdk-8-jdk - bellsoft-java11-full
- openjfx=8u161-b12-1ubuntu2
- libopenjfx-java=8u161-b12-1ubuntu2
- libopenjfx-jni=8u161-b12-1ubuntu2
homebrew: homebrew:
update: true update: true
packages: packages:
@ -53,17 +50,17 @@ install:
before_script: before_script:
- if [ $TRAVIS_OS_NAME = linux ]; then - if [ $TRAVIS_OS_NAME = linux ]; then
sudo update-alternatives --set java /usr/lib/jvm/java-8-openjdk-amd64/jre/bin/java; sudo update-alternatives --set java /usr/lib/jvm/bellsoft-java11-full/bin/java;
sudo update-alternatives --set javac /usr/lib/jvm/java-8-openjdk-amd64/bin/javac; sudo update-alternatives --set javac /usr/lib/jvm/bellsoft-java11-full/bin/javac;
export PATH=/usr/bin:$PATH; export PATH=/usr/bin:$PATH;
unset JAVA_HOME; unset JAVA_HOME;
fi fi
- if [ $TRAVIS_OS_NAME = osx ]; then - if [ $TRAVIS_OS_NAME = osx ]; then
brew uninstall java --force; brew uninstall java --force;
brew cask uninstall java --force; brew cask uninstall java --force;
brew tap homebrew/cask-versions; brew tap bell-sw/liberica;
brew cask install corretto8; brew cask install liberica-jdk11-full;
export JAVA_HOME=/Library/Java/JavaVirtualMachines/amazon-corretto-8.jdk/Contents/Home; export JAVA_HOME=/Library/Java/JavaVirtualMachines/liberica-jdk-11.0.8/Contents/Home;
fi fi
- java -version - java -version